Headed to Europe for skiing. Flights were 2.5k total (3 + infant, around $750 per person other than infant). Hotel was 2.5k. Food will probably be 2k. Skiing will be ~1.5k including ski school for a couple days (so much cheaper than the US…). Transit to and from airport about $400.
So about 9k total. |

I used points to offset the flight costs. I paid cash for 3 flights and used points for 2. For the resort, I have refundable bookings for a few different resorts that I made during Black Friday sales and I check periodically to see if the prices go down. I just saved $500 a couple of weeks ago by calling Costco when the price went down for one of the resorts I booked. The price went up again after and is now much more than what I reserved. I’ll make a final decision on the resort by the cancellation date based on the final price and current reviews. |
